Professional Experience
Scott Silverberg is Americas Head of Client Solutions for CBRE Investment Management, based in New York. In this role, Scott leads the team of Americas-based Client Solutions Officers at CBRE IM and has responsibility for driving engagement with Americas-based investors. Scott works closely with each of CBRE IM’s investment lines—including Direct Real Estate, Indirect Real Estate, Listed Real Assets and Private Infrastructure—to help deliver real assets solutions for clients.
Prior to joining the firm in 2024, Scott led Strategic Partnerships at Oxford Properties where he was responsible for partner relationship management and capital formation activities. Previous to Oxford, Scott spent over a decade helping to build the real estate and infrastructure investment programs in the U.S. and Europe for Nippon Life Global Investors. Earlier in his career, he held positions at Brookfield Properties, Tishman Speyer and CBRE.
Scott earned a Bachelor of Environmental Design Studies in Architecture from Dalhousie University, a Bachelor of Arts in Urban Development from Western University, and a Master of Science in Real Estate Development from Columbia University. He maintains active affiliations with the Urban Land Institute, Pension Real Estate Association, the Association of Foreign Investors in Real Estate, and the National Association of Corporate Directors.
